Roof Damage Inspection Services
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ues and potential vulnerabilities. These inspections typically include a visual examination of the roof's surface, checking for signs of wear, cracks, missing shingles, or other visible damage. In some cases, service providers may also utilize specialized equipment such as drones or infrared cameras to detect problems that are not immediately visible to the naked eye. The goal is to provide property owners with a clear understanding of the roof’s current condition and any areas that may require repair or maintenance.
This service helps address common problems associated with roof deterioration, such as leaks, water intrusion, and structural weaknesses. Early detection of damage can prevent minor issues from escalating into more severe and costly repairs. Inspections can also uncover damage caused by severe weather, fallen debris, or aging materials, ensuring that property owners are aware of potential risks that could compromise the safety and integrity of their buildings. Regular roof inspections are especially valuable for maintaining the longevity of the roof and avoiding unexpected failures that could lead to interior damage or mold growth.

The overview below groups typical Roof Damage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Woodbridge,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Inspection Costs - Typical expenses for roof damage inspections range from $100 to $300, depending on the property's size and location. For example, a standard residential roof in Woodbridge, NJ, might cost around $150 for a thorough assessment.
Repair Estimates - After inspection, repair cost estimates generally fall between $500 and $3,000. Minor repairs, such as patching small leaks, may be closer to $500, while extensive damage could be higher.
Service Fees - Some service providers charge flat fees for roof inspections, often between $75 and $200. Additional costs may apply if further evaluation or detailed reports are requested.
Cost Factors - Costs vary based on roof size, pitch, and accessibility, with larger or more complex roofs typically incurring higher fees.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ific roof conditions and locations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s of roof damage? Common indicators include missing or broken shingles, water stains on ceilings, and visible sagging or curling of roof materials.
How can a roof damage inspection help? It helps identify existing issues early, preventing further damage and informing necessary repairs or maintenance.
Who should perform a roof damage inspection? A qualified roofing contractor or service provider experienced in roof assessments can conduct thorough inspections.
When is the best time to schedule a roof inspection? After severe weather events or periodically as part of routine maintenance to ensure roof integrity.
What does a roof damage inspection typically include? It involves a visual assessment of the roof surface, gutters, and attic (if accessible) to detect damage or deterioration.
